Looking for Immigration Lawyers in Murrieta?

Immigration lawyers help individuals, families, and businesses navigate the complex laws governing entry and residence in the United States. They handle matters such as visas, green cards, citizenship applications, asylum claims, and deportation defense. Their expertise is crucial for overcoming bureaucratic hurdles and achieving immigration goals successfully.

How long does it take until an immigration application gets reviewed?

default-avatar
Answered by attorney Marie Andree Michaud (Unclaimed Profile)
Immigration lawyer at Marie Michaud, Attorney At Law
Depends on your country of birth. See the visa bulletin for August 2011. Mexicans with an approved I-130 (filed by an American brother or sister) that was filed before March 8, 1996 can file for adjustment starting August 1. Filipinos with an approved I-130 (filed by an American brother or sister) that was filed before May 15, 1988 can file for adjustment starting August 1. Indians, Chinese and all others with an approved I-130 (filed by an American brother or sister) that was filed before March 8, 1996 can file for adjustment starting August 1. Consult an attorney who will check your admissibility issues (previous deportation, trips in and out the US after period of unlawful presences, criminal history, fraud, etc.) to make sure you qualify. Good luck.
